Mobil uygulama nasıl yapılır
Mobil uygulama yapmak için birkaç adımı takip etmeniz gerekir:
- Koncept ve Amaç: Uygulamanın ne yapmasını istediğinizi ve kullanıcıların ne beklediğini belirlemelisiniz.
- Tasarım ve Kullanıcı Deneyimi: Uygulamanın tasarımı ve kullanıcı deneyimini belirlemelisiniz. Kullanıcı arayüzünün ne kadar kolay kullanılabilir ve güzel görünmesi gerektiği önemlidir.
- Teknolojik Alt Yapı: Uygulamanız için hangi teknolojilerin kullanılması gerektiğine karar vermelisiniz. Mobil platformlar için native (Android ve iOS) veya cross-platform (React Native, Flutter vb.) geliştirme yolları bulunmaktadır.
- Uygulamanın Kodlanması: Uygulamanızı kodlamaya başlamadan önce tasarım ve kullanıcı deneyimi belirlemelisiniz. Uygulamanızın tüm özelliklerini ve fonksiyonalitelerini eklemeniz gerekir.
- Test Etme ve Debugging: Uygulamanızı test etmeli ve hata ayıklamalısınız. Uygulamanın tüm özelliklerinin doğru çalıştığından emin olmalısınız.
- Yayımlama: Uygulamanızı yayımlamak için App Store (iOS) veya Google Play Store (Android) gibi platformlardan birine göndermelisiniz. Uygulamanızın güncel ve güvenli olduğundan emin olmalısınız.
Bu adımlar size mobil uygulama yapmak için bir başlangıç noktası verebilir. Detaylı bir mobil uygulama yapmak isteyenler için profesyonel bir eğitim almak veya bir uygulama geliştirme ekibi ile çalışmak en iyisi olabilir.
Mobil uygulama yaparken dikkat etmeniz gereken birçok faktör bulunmaktadır. Bunlar arasında şunlar bulunabilir:
- Kullanıcı Deneyimi: Uygulamanızın kullanıcılar tarafından rahat ve kolay kullanılabilir olması önemlidir. Tasarım ve navigasyon, kullanıcıların ihtiyaçlarına göre şekillendirilmelidir.
- Performans: Uygulamanızın hızlı ve kesintisiz çalışması beklenir. Ayrıca, fazla miktarda bellek ve enerji tasarrufu yapması da beklenir.
- Güvenlik: Kullanıcı verilerinin güvenliği önemlidir. Gizli veriler (şifreler, kredi kartı bilgileri vb.) güvenli bir şekilde saklanmalı veya şifrelenmelidir.
- Uyumluluk: Uygulamanız, farklı cihaz modelleri ve işletim sistemleriyle uyumlu olmalıdır. Ayrıca, ekran boyutları, çözünürlük ve diğer fiziksel özellikler de dikkate alınmalıdır.
- Yapılabilirlik: Uygulamanızın özellikleri ve fonksiyonaliteleri, mevcut teknolojik alt yapıya uygun olmalıdır. Ayrıca, uygulamanın zaman içinde güncellenebilmesi ve geliştirilebilmesi de önemlidir.
- Fiyatlandırma ve Monetizasyon: Uygulamanızın fiyatlandırması ve monetizasyon stratejisi belirlenmelidir. Ücretsiz, freemium veya abonelik temelli bir yapıya sahip olabilirsiniz.
Bu faktörlere dikkat etmeniz, mobil uygulamanızın başarılı ve kullanıcılar tarafından beğenilen bir uygulama olmasını sağlayabilir.